[0001] This utility model relates to the field of household appliances, specifically a food processor. Background Technology
[0002] A food processor is a multi-functional kitchen appliance that integrates cutting, grinding, chopping, and juicing functions. It efficiently and conveniently processes various ingredients, greatly simplifying the tedious steps of cooking. Whether making delicate baby food, delicious juice, grinding spices, or mixing batter, a food processor can handle it all with ease, bringing great convenience and efficiency to the family kitchen. Its compact design and simple operation allow users to easily master and quickly complete food processing, making it an indispensable and practical tool in the modern family kitchen.
[0003] Existing food processors typically lack anti-disassembly features during processing. If a user accidentally disassembles the blade assembly due to improper operation, safety issues arise. First, once the blade assembly is disassembled, food, whether awaiting processing or already processed, is highly likely to spill out, resulting in food waste and environmental pollution. More seriously, if the blade assembly contains a motor, accidental disassembly could lead to an electric shock risk, damaging the equipment and threatening the user's safety. Furthermore, if the cup contains hot food, disassembly could cause it to splatter, resulting in burns. Utility Model Content
[0004] (a) Technical problems to be solved
[0005] In view of the shortcomings of the existing technology, this utility model provides a food processor that solves the problem that existing food processors usually do not have an anti-disassembly function during processing.
[0006] (II) Technical Solution
[0007]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model provides the following technical solution: a food processor, comprising a main unit, a blade assembly, a cup body assembly, and a cup lid assembly; the blade assembly is provided with an anti-rotation plate and a heat insulation cover, a spring is provided between the anti-rotation plate and the heat insulation cover, and a protrusion is provided on the anti-rotation plate; the cup body assembly includes a cup shell, an anti-rotation rib is provided on the cup shell, a connecting rod is provided on the cup shell, a spring is sleeved on the connecting rod, and the connecting rod is provided with an anti-rotation rib; the blade assembly also includes a cover plate, and the cover plate is provided with an anti-rotation rib; the cup lid assembly includes a lower cover, and the lower cover has a beveled structure.
[0008] Preferably, the cup assembly is placed on the main unit, the weight of the cup assembly is greater than the elastic force of the spring, and the anti-rotation plate slides upward along the heat insulation cover guide rail.
[0009] Preferably, the outer shell of the cup body has a hole for the connecting rod anti-rotation rib to extend into, and the knife holder assembly can be rotated open.
[0010] Preferably, the connecting rod can control the opening and closing of the micro switch by the difference in magnetic attraction distance.
[0011] (III) Beneficial Effects
[0012] Compared with the prior art, the present invention provides a food processor with the following beneficial effects:
[0013] 1. In this utility model, the double anti-accidental touch design of placing the cup body on the main unit and the cup lid fastening ensures that the knife holder assembly cannot be opened as long as either scenario is met. This directly avoids the risk of food spillage, electric leakage or burns caused by accidental disassembly of the knife holder during processing from a mechanical structure perspective, providing more comprehensive protection.
[0014] 2. In this utility model, while ensuring safety against accidental contact, the blade holder assembly still has the characteristic of being detachable. It can only be disassembled when the cup body is lifted and the cup lid is not fastened. This solves the problems of traditional non-detachable food processors being difficult to clean and blades trapping residue, without increasing the complexity of operation due to safety design, resulting in a better user experience. Detailed Implementation

[0028] Please see Figure 1 - Figure 11 A food processor includes a main unit 101, a blade assembly 201, a cup body assembly 301, and a lid assembly 401. The blade assembly 201 has an anti-rotation plate 202 and a heat insulation cover 203. A spring 204 is disposed between the anti-rotation plate 202 and the heat insulation cover 203. The anti-rotation plate 202 has a protrusion. The cup body assembly 301 includes a cup body shell 302, which has an anti-rotation rib. A connecting rod 303 is mounted on the cup body shell 302, and a spring 304 is sleeved on the connecting rod 303. The connecting rod 303 also has an anti-rotation rib. The blade assembly 201 also has a cover plate 205, which has an anti-rotation rib. The lid assembly 401 includes a lower lid 402, which has a beveled edge structure.
[0029] In this embodiment, when the cup assembly 301 is lifted, the anti-rotation plate 202, under the elastic force of the spring 204, can maintain its initial position. At this time, the distance between the end face of the anti-rotation plate 202 and the end face of the heat insulation cover 203 is significantly greater than the distance between the end face of the heat insulation cover 203 and the end face of the anti-rotation rib of the cup shell 302. Due to this distance relationship, the protrusion on the anti-rotation plate 202 will not be blocked by any structure, thereby allowing the knife holder assembly 201 to be opened for normal operation.
[0030] When the cup assembly 301 is placed on the main unit 101, the weight of the cup assembly 301 exceeds the elastic force of the spring 204, causing the anti-rotation plate 202 to slide upward along the guide rail of the heat insulation cover 203. This sliding process makes the distance between the end face of the anti-rotation plate 202 and the end face of the heat insulation cover 203 smaller than the distance between the end face of the heat insulation cover 203 and the end face of the anti-rotation rib of the cup shell 302. In this case, the anti-rotation rib of the cup shell 302 can just block the protruding part of the anti-rotation plate 202, so that the knife holder assembly 201 cannot be opened. This design effectively avoids the spillage of food in the cup, the occurrence of electric leakage, and the potential risk of burns.
[0031] The outer shell 302 of the cup body has a hole for the anti-rotation rib of the connecting rod 303 to extend into. When the cup lid assembly 401 is not fastened, the second spring 304 will generate an upward force, so that the distance between the end face of the anti-rotation rib of the connecting rod 303 and the end face of the cover plate 205 is greater than the height of the anti-rotation rib on the cover plate 205. In this state, there is no interference between the anti-rotation rib of the connecting rod 303 and the anti-rotation rib of the cover plate 205, and the knife holder assembly 201 can rotate and open freely.
[0032] When the cup lid assembly 401 is fastened, the beveled structure on the lower cover 402 of the cup lid will press down on the connecting rod 303 until the anti-rotation rib of the connecting rod 303 contacts the end face of the cover plate 205. At this time, the distance between the end face of the anti-rotation rib of the connecting rod 303 and the end face of the cover plate 205 becomes less than the height of the anti-rotation rib on the cover plate 205. The anti-rotation rib of the connecting rod 303 and the anti-rotation rib of the cover plate 205 limit each other, so that the knife holder assembly 201 cannot be opened, further avoiding the risk of accidental contact and ensuring safety during use.
